As we all know, cancer brings to people the physical trauma, the threat of life, as well as the destruction of one’s original state of life. Cancer is an uninvited visitor of life, although in some developed countries and regions of the world, people have generally seen cancer as a chronic disease, even some among them just treat cancer as a part of life, and live in peace with them. However in China, the situation is different, people see cancer as a sign of life is coming to the end, they feel great sadness and fear about that, and lack of the courage to face up to it.Breast cancer brings great threat to women’s life, it takes up great pain to both of one’s body and mind, and greatly affects the one’s quality of life.Based on this, this paper will mainly adopts the method of qualitative research, discusses the following two questions:1. How about the breast cancer patients’ physical, psychological and social support condition of comprehensive state during, the perioperative period?2. Whether can we develop some intervention model according to the characteristics of perioperative patients with breast cancer, and using a variety of practical methods for interactive comprehensive treatment?This paper also come up with some suggestions both in social policy and clinical practice, with the hope to provide empirical reference for study of breast cancer patients’ groups.
